Quote:
Envix said:
Quote:
paradoxlost said: 4.6 mile run in 35 minutes and 25 seconds today. Took 45 seconds off my last time, which was 3 minutes faster than the time before that. Average mile time 7:46. Get at me brothers. Where's the cardio at, you guys are all bi's and tri's, purely glamour muscles.
cardio isn't really that great for you especially when done chronically it causes increased cortisol which can lower testosterone and fuck up your endocrine system
cardio is much better for, well, your cardiovascular health than resistance training. the cortisol response to intense cardio is a natural evolutionary response that mobilizes blood sugar by inhibiting insulin from moving it into the cells. becoming skinnyfat as a result of being a marathon runner is definitely a thing, but everyone who isn't an elite level powerlifter/bodybuilder can benefit from a 20 minute 160-180bpm cardio daily sesh. and frankly those guys would benefit from it too, just not in the way they want to benefit.
the primary inducer of hypercortisolism is just plain stress... bills, relationships, work, etc. increases in glutamate > GABA conversion associated with reasonable amounts of cardio will outweigh any subjective problems caused by exercise induced cortisol increases

at comparable levels of training they absolutely do. takes a toll on your joints. you also have to keep in mind though that a lot of those dudes are taking anabolic steroids which are terrible for you in terms of heart health and susceptibility to cancer
i lift high reps at weight pretty well below what i am capable of lifting. in terms of muscle growth the only thing that matters is total volume, you dont have to lift heavy. but lifting heavy will make you stronger despite equal amounts of muscle growth

yea most people have the misconception that you gotta train like arnold swartzeneiger to see progress but truth is he was an addict. normal people do not have to train like that to see results.
20-40 minutes, 3 times a week and you will see amazing results in 6 months, as long as you increase weight incrementally. just an additional 5lbs every 2 weeks. don't go so high that you lose good posture. and training to failure isn't really necessary, as long as you're gaining enough strength to increase the weight every couple of weeks.
i would say 10 minutes of cardio is plenty to reap the vascular benefits. overdo it and you could end up losing your hair and start getting pizza face like a highschool kid
